Cloudflare and DNSOMATIC
Hello, looking for guidance / support.
I have my domain (call it abcd.com) managed through cloudflare setup as follows:
A @ My WAN IP
CNAME subsite1 abcd.com
CNAME subsite2 abcd.com
Now when I configure DNSOMATIC to update my A record, I keep getting an error saying 'record' not found when I set hostname as abcd.com and domain as abcd.com.
Any ideas as to how I can get DNSOMATIC to update my A record through DNSOMATIC without needing to setup multiple A records for each subsite.

I just configured DNS-O-Matic with Cloudflare using that link above.
As of the date of this posting you need to use the GLOBAL API KEY not the API token. Suggest that the OpenDNS team update the html code to state Global API Key instead of API token.
This is quite a significant security flaw given the OpenDNS/Cisco are in the business of security. In the event that your dnsomatic account is breached the cloudflare global key can cause some damage depending on what you host.
